[ES] Se describe la variación temporal de la estructura, biomasa y contenido de carbono, nitrógeno y fósforo de la pradera de Caularpa prolifera en el Mar Menor (SE de España) desde noviembre de 1986 a marzo de 1989. La pradera muestra un ciclo anual unimodal de desarrollo vegetativo con valores máximos de biomasa (168-173 g d.w. m-2) durante el verano y el otoño, y mínimos (0-57 g d.w. m-2) durante el invierno y principios de la primavera. Los valores del índice de área foliar oscilaron entre 0.37-0.40 m2 m-2 en enero-febrero y 2.60-7.06 m2 m-2 en julio. Los cambios temporales en la biomasa y estructura de la pradera se deben principalmente a la estacionalidad en el desarrollo vegetativo de los frondes secundarios. El contenido de nitrógeno del talo mostró una pauta anual bimodal con valores mayores en primavera y otoño (>2.5% peso seco) que en verano e invierno (<2.5% p.s.), mientras que los contenidos de carbono (32.5-34.8% p.s.) y fósforo (0.065-0.069% p.s.) no mostraron una pauta temporal definida.
[EN] The temporal changes in the structure, biomass and C, N and P content of meadows of Caulerpa prolifera (Forsskal) Lamouroux in the Mar Menor coastal lagoon (SE Spain) are described over the period from November 1986 to March 1989. C. prolifera meadows showed a unimodal pattern of vegetative development with maximum biomass values (168-173 g d.w. m-2) reached in summer and maintained during autumn, and minimum biomass values (0-57 g d.w. m-2) during late winter and early spring. Leaf area index values changed between 0.37-0.40 m2 m-2 in January-February and 2.60-7.06 m2 m-2 in July. The seasonality in the biomass and structure of the meadow was mainly related to the vegetative development of secondary fronts. Carbon and phosphorus content of the thallus (32.5-34.8% d.w. and 0.065-0.069% d.w., respectively) had no seasonality , but nitrogen content showed a bimodal annual pattern with higher values in spring and fall (>2.5% d.w.) than in summer and winter (<2.5% d.w.).
